ROCKY MOUNTAIN WORD SCRAMBLE.


These scrambled words are all about rock climbing rock climbing Sports medicine An 'extreme sport' in which the participant climbs rock formations, with or without ropes Injury risk Fractures, abrasions, death. See Extreme sports. . Can you unscramble Same as decrypt. See scramble.  them? The clues will help you.

PRELPA--

Clue! This is how to get from the top of a rock down to the ground.

Rappel

BARSCNEARI--

Clue! These metal clips connect the climbing harness A climbing harness is a piece of equipment used in certain types of rock-climbing, abseiling or other activities requiring the use of ropes to provide access and/or safety (eg industrial rope access, working at heights, etc.).  to the rope.

Carabiners

FLCFI--

Clue! It's a steep rock.

Cliff

KLCAH--

Clue! It keeps hands dry while climbing.

Chalk

INGLOUBDER--

Clue! It means learning how to rock-climb on small rocks.

Bouldering bould·er·ing  
n. Sports
Basic or intermediate climbing carried out on relatively small rocks that can be traversed without great risk of bodily harm in case of a fall.
 

STEVERE--

Clue! It's the tallest mountain on dry land.

Everest

MEHLTE--

Clue! This protects the head.

Helmet
